(In reply to Michael Stahl from comment #8)
> i disagree that clearing the Undo history should be considered dataLoss
> - by that logic, every crash would be a dataLoss too, and we'd need
> a new keyword for the i-load-a-file-and-store-it-and-oops-my-text-is-gone
> disasters.

I don't now. One could argue that it's worse than a crash in terms of data
loss. Because in the case of a crash there are recent backups which can be
restored on the next start. While with this issue, one would need to purposely
crash LO to get to those. A normal user would not know that - they would just
consider the data lost. And the backups would be purged on the next regular LO
shutdown.

But this might be another duplicate of the bug 38703.
